Comprehensive Technical Overview of Methylestradiol
Methylestradiol, a potent synthetic estrogenic compound, represents a critical milestone in the evolution of steroid chemistry. In the modern landscape of biochemical research and pharmaceutical development, the demand for highly stable, high-purity Methylestradiol has surged. As a derivative of estradiol, this molecule is engineered to provide specific metabolic advantages, making it a subject of intense study in endocrinology and molecular biology. For procurement managers and technical directors, understanding the nuances of this chemical is essential for maintaining the integrity of their R&D pipelines.
At its core, the molecular structure of Methylestradiol is designed to interact with estrogen receptors with high affinity. This structural modification—typically the addition of a methyl group—alters the metabolic pathway of the compound compared to its natural counterparts. This alteration is not merely a structural curiosity; it is a functional necessity in research scenarios where prolonged half-life or specific binding characteristics are required. The synthesis and production of Methylestradiol require an incredibly sophisticated environment. Because it falls under the category of specialized steroid derivatives, the chemical's stability is highly sensitive to environmental factors such as light, temperature, and oxidation. This is why the quality assurance protocols of a supplier are just as important as the molecular formula itself. A professional-grade Methylestradiol must demonstrate a purity profile of at least 98-99%, as even trace amounts of impurities can lead to unintended biological feedback loops in experimental models. This level of precision is what separates industrial-grade chemicals from research-grade reagents.
From a structural perspective, the presence of the methyl group at a specific position on the steroid nucleus enhances its resistance to certain metabolic degradation processes. This characteristic makes Methylestradiol a valuable tool in studying estrogen-responsive gene expression.
